Your 1992 Cutlass Ciera may be hesitating and backfiring due to several potential issues. Common causes include a faulty ignition system, such as worn spark plugs or a malfunctioning ignition coil, which can disrupt the spark needed for proper combustion. Additionally, problems with the fuel system, such as a clogged fuel filter or failing fuel pump, can lead to inadequate fuel delivery. Finally, issues with the air intake system, like a dirty air filter or a malfunctioning mass airflow sensor, could also contribute to these symptoms.

The 1992 Cutlass Ciera with a 3.3L engine typically requires about 2.5 to 3.0 pounds of R-134a refrigerant for proper air conditioning operation. It's important to check the vehicle's specifications or the under-hood label for the exact amount, as it can vary slightly based on system configuration. Always ensure the system is evacuated and recharged properly to avoid damage.
